Abstract
Embodiments provide methods and systems for the modeling and analysis of visual fields. Methods for global and regional measurement of visual sensitivity and quantification of field loss are provided in accordance with various embodiments. Further embodiments provide systems and methods for the diagnosis of diseases affecting the visual field. In addition, embodiments provide methods and systems for measuring and quantifying the volume of the Hill of Vision for an individual subject.
